Houston Wire & Cable Company Reports Results for the Quarter Ended March 31, 2015
Marketwired
HOUSTON, TX--(Marketwired - May 7, 2015) - Houston Wire & Cable Company (NASDAQ: HWCC) (the "Company") announced operating results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2015.
Selected quarterly highlights were:
Sales of $81.6 million
Net income of $2.2 million
Diluted EPS of $0.13
Cash flow of $10.3 million
Declared a dividend of $0.12 cents per share on May 5, 2015
First Quarter Summary Jim Pokluda, President and Chief Executive Officer commented, "The sharp decline in oil prices in the latter part of 2014, which depressed industrial demand, and the deflation in the price of metals, both affected the level of our business activity during the first quarter. Sales decreased 18.6% from the first quarter of 2014, or approximately 14.3% when adjusted for declining metals prices. We estimate that Maintenance, Repair and Operations (MRO) sales fell 9% or approximately 5% on a metals-adjusted basis, while project sales decreased approximately 33%, or 29% on a metals-adjusted basis. Metals adjusted project and total sales excluding the negative impact resulting from a decline in a large and ongoing infrastructure project fell 9% and 7% respectively. Total transactional invoice activity decreased by approximately 5%."
Gross margin at 21.7% increased 10 basis points from the first quarter of 2014. Operating expenses at $14.0 million fell 8.8% or $1.4 million from Q1 2014 and by $0.5 million on a sequential basis. Pokluda commented "Despite a very difficult operating environment, our gross margin controls and cost savings initiatives are working and I am pleased with the results of those efforts.
"Reduced market demand has not compromised HWCC's pricing power in the core area of our business involving MRO transactions, and although the present day pull-back in large capital project spend is frustrating, the long term fundamentals for this market opportunity are intact. Channel feedback continues to indicate exceptionally high levels of customer satisfaction, continued growth in market share and increasing support for our product line expansions into highly engineered power and control cable, aluminum cable and specialty oil and gas cable."
Interest expense of $0.3 million was flat with the prior year period. Average debt levels decreased by 10.7% from $54.9 million in 2014 to $49.1 million in 2015, while the effective interest rate increased from 1.9% in 2014 to 2.0% in 2015. The effective tax rate for the quarter of 36.8% was down from the 2014 tax rate of 38.4% primarily due to lower state tax rates in 2015.
Net income of $2.2 million decreased 41.6% from the first quarter of 2014. Diluted earnings per share were $0.13 compared to $0.21 in the prior year quarter.
Mr Pokluda further commented "As we move further into the year, prudent use of working capital, expense management, gross margin optimization, and new business development initiatives will remain top priorities."

About the Company With over 39 years of experience in the industry, Houston Wire & Cable Company is one of the largest providers of wire and cable in the U.S. market. Headquartered in Houston, Texas, the Company has sales and distribution facilities strategically located throughout the nation.
Standard stock items available for immediate delivery include: continuous and interlocked armor, instrumentation, medium voltage, high temperature, portable cord, power cables, primary and secondary aluminum distribution cables, private branded products, including LifeGuard™, a low-smoke, zero-halogen cable, mechanical wire and cable and related hardware, including wire rope, lifting products and synthetic rope and slings. Comprehensive value-added services include same-day shipping, knowledgeable sales staff, inventory management programs, just-in-time delivery, logistics support, customized internet-based ordering capabilities and 24/7/365 service.
